China & WorldSuper Typhoon Bavi Makes Landfall in Eastern China Forcing Over 1.7 Million Evacuations
Super Typhoon Bavi made landfall in Zhejiang Province on July 10-11, 2026. Over 1.7 million residents were evacuated.
Super Typhoon Bavi made landfall in Zhejiang Province on July 10, 2026 at night. The storm reached Yuhuan with maximum wind speeds of 60 meters per second.
This marks the strongest typhoon to make landfall in China in 2026. The Chinese government issued a Level IV emergency response for flood control and disaster prevention.
Over 1.7 million residents from Zhejiang, Fujian and surrounding provinces were evacuated.
Hundreds of flights were cancelled and railway transportation services were adjusted due to the typhoon threat.
Approximately 1,300 trees were blown down in Wenzhou and Leqing areas.
Before reaching China, Super Typhoon Bavi previously impacted Japan and Taiwan with heavy rainfall and strong winds.
The typhoons scale is approximately equivalent to France in size.
Emergency rescue teams were mobilized across affected provinces to coordinate evacuation operations.
Government agencies maintained vigilance against secondary disasters such as flash floods and landslides.
Coastal regions experienced severe storm surge and significant weather impact throughout the event.
The typhoon represents one of the strongest storms to impact China in recent years causing significant economic losses.
